Mathnasium was founded in 2002 and started franchising in 2003. The first Mathnasium Learning Center was opened in Los Angeles in late 2002 by education industry pioneers Peter Markovitz and David Ullendorff and educator and curriculum consultant Larry Martinek, who created the Mathnasium Method. Mathnasium franchisees now operate over 1,200 centers in 12 countries, working with K–12 students of all skill levels.
